Finding and eliminating the source of the unpleasant odor
The first and most logical step will be to revise the contents. Carefully inspect every corner, including door pockets and vegetable drawers. Spoiled food is the most common reason that is easily overlooked if it is lying on the bottom.
Pay special attention to food in open containers. Cheese, sausage or fish can emit an odor even when wrapped in plastic if the packaging is not airtight. Absorption of aromas Plastic shelves happen faster than it seems.
⚠️ Attention: If you find mold on the walls of the chamber, the usual washing may not help. The mycelium penetrates into microcracks in the plastic, requiring the use of antibacterial agents or replacement of the seal.
Check the condition of the drainage hole. It is located on the back wall and serves to drain melt water. If it is clogged with crumbs or mucus, the water begins to stagnate and “bloom”, producing a fetid odor.
To clean hard-to-reach places, use cotton swabs or special brushes. Carefully clean the channel, being careful not to damage its walls. After the procedure, spill it with a small amount of warm water to check the passability.
Proper defrosting and washing of internal surfaces
General cleaning is the foundation of freshness. Even if there is no visible dirt, the fatty deposits on the walls oxidize over time and begin to smell. Before starting the procedure, be sure unplug the device from the power supply.
Remove all removable elements: shelves, drawers, egg trays. It is better to wash them separately in the bath or shower using warm water. Plastic and glass tolerate contact with water well, unlike the metal casing of the case.

To wash the inner walls, use a soft sponge. Abrasive powders can scratch the surface, creating an ideal environment for future dirt to accumulate. Movements should be smooth, without strong pressure.
⚠️ Attention: Never use hot water to defrost ice if you decide to speed up the process. A sharp temperature change can lead to cracks in the evaporator or deformation of the plastic.
Pay special attention to the rubber door seal. Food debris and dirt often accumulate in its folds. Gently peel back the cuff and wipe every millimeter of surface. This is where black mold most often settles black mold.
Folk remedies for neutralizing odors
If mechanical cleaning does not give a complete result, natural absorbents will come to the rescue. They are safe for health and effective against light odors. Many of these products are always on hand in any kitchen.
Activated carbon is considered one of the best natural filters. It has a porous structure that perfectly absorbs odor molecules. It is enough to crush 10-15 tablets and scatter the powder into saucers.
- 🍋 Lemon zest: fresh citrus peel not only eliminates odors, but also leaves a pleasant aroma.
- ☕ Ground coffee: dry powder in an open container works as a powerful absorber of foreign odors.
- 🍞 Black bread: a slice of rye bread left on a saucer quickly absorbs unpleasant notes.
- 🧂 Baking soda: an open pack of soda is a classic remedy for combating dampness and mustiness.
Such absorbers need to be changed regularly, about once every two weeks. Over time, their effectiveness decreases and they stop working. Natural ingredients safe even if accidentally spilled inside the chamber.
Why shouldn’t you use vinegar in its pure form?
Acetic acid perfectly disinfects, but its pungent odor lasts a very long time weathered. If you clean your refrigerator with pure vinegar, you will have to wait several days for the aroma to dissipate, which may temporarily ruin the taste of the stored food. It is better to use a weak solution.

Features of cleaning the No Frost system
Owners of refrigerators with the system No Frost often face a situation where everything seems to be clean, but there is a smell. The problem may be hidden in hidden elements of the air circulation system. In such models, the air is constantly driven by a fan.
If there is a piece of spoiled product left somewhere in the air ducts or under the plastic casing, the smell will spread throughout the entire chamber instantly. It can be difficult to get there yourself without partial disassembly.
You need to remove the back panel inside the freezer or refrigerator compartment. Below it there is an evaporator and a fan. Carefully inspect these components for the presence of ice, dirt or foreign objects.
⚠️ Attention: Disassembling the refrigerator may void the warranty. If the device is under warranty service, it is better to call a specialist to carry out a deep cleaning of the system.
The fan should be cleaned carefully so as not to damage the blades. Dust and dirt on them can become a source of odor when the engine heats up. Use a dry brush or vacuum cleaner at minimum power.
Preventing the appearance of odors
The best way to deal with a problem is to prevent it from occurring. Following simple hygiene rules will keep your refrigerator fresh for years. Regularity is the key to success.
Store food in closed containers. This will not only prevent odors from mixing, but will also extend the shelf life of the food. Open pots and bowls are the enemy of clean air in the cell.
- 📅 Inspect the products once a week, throwing away anything that is in doubt.
- 🧼 Wipe the shelves with a damp cloth immediately after spilling liquids.
- 🌡️ Monitor the temperature so that food does not spoil faster than time.
Use special mats for shelves. They are made from materials that are easy to clean and do not absorb odors. Replacing such a mat is much easier than washing the entire chamber.
Do not put hot food in the refrigerator. This creates condensation and an ideal environment for bacteria to grow, which inevitably leads to a musty smell. Let the dishes cool to room temperature.
Frequently asked questions (FAQ)
How to quickly remove the smell of fish from the refrigerator?
The fish smell is very persistent. A solution of citric acid or slices of fresh lemon placed around the chamber will help best. Ventilation during the day with the doors open is also effective.
Can an ozonizer be used for disinfection?
Yes, a household ozonator is an excellent tool. It kills bacteria and neutralizes odors. However, while the device is operating, there should be no food in the chamber, and after the procedure, you need to ventilate the refrigerator.
Why did the smell appear after the equipment had been idle for a long time?
During a long shutdown, mold could develop in a closed space. It is necessary to thoroughly wash the refrigerator with a solution of soda or vinegar and dry it with the door open.
Is it safe to use car fragrances?
No, car fragrances contain chemicals that are not intended for contact with food. Their use can be hazardous to health.
How often should you change the filters in the refrigerator?
If your model has carbon filters for air purification, they should be changed every 6 months or according to the manufacturer's instructions, otherwise they themselves will become a source of odor.
